    ‘The Shards’ Casts React to Homer Gere’s Wild Dance Scene (Exclusive)

    AdminBy AdminAugust 13, 2026 Television
    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Email Reddit Telegram

    The jury is still out on whether The Shards‘ Robert Mallory is the serial killer known as The Trawler, but he certainly is guilty of slaying it on the dance floor.

    “I can’t wait for the TikToks because then I can just let it play again and again and again,” laughs Graham Campbell of costar Homer Gere‘s sure-to-be-memed moves in “Robert’s Party,” the fourth episode of the series.

    Ever since the enigmatic Mallory transferred to the ritzy Los Angeles high school, Ryan Murphy‘s increasingly addictive adaptation of Bret Easton Ellis‘ 2023 novel has given us every reason to suspect the guy of very bad behavior. First off is the timing. He showed up on the scene just as bodies started piling up. And secondly, he says he’s never been to the area before, despite classmate Bret (the Topher Grace-ful Igby Rigney) swearing that he spotted him at a screening of The Shining a year earlier. He also had some shady interactions with now-missing student Matt Kellner (Owen Painter), and now, there is the little matter of his stint at a psychiatric facility and the questionable death of his own mother.

    Still, the clearly smitten Susan Reynolds (Kaia Gerber, who gets more fascinating with every episode) insists he’s a real one, even going so far as to throw a bash for him at her father’s Hollywood Hills mansion despite the reluctance of her actual boyfriend, Thom Wright (Campbell). Of course, it’s such a coke-fueled mess of popped collars, shoulder pads, and Aquanet that the cultist who corners Bret’s neglected girlfriend, Debbie Schaffer (Hayes Warner, another evolving breakout), during her secret hookup with a porn star isn’t even the worst part of the night. Nope, that honor goes to Robert, who opts to throw booze on top of whatever meds he’s been taking and starts to shake what his (dead) mama gave him to strains of Lipps, Inc.’s “Funkytown.”

    “It rocks,” enthuses Gerber. “And it was so fun because we didn’t get to see it until we were filming it.”

    “And then we saw a lot of it,” adds Campbell. “Close at hand!”

    “He committed 100% every single take,” Gerber continues. “And those reactions that you’re seeing are genuinely our real reactions to seeing Homer do that.”

    So, do you think Robert is a killer? Or is Bret’s fixation with him, as Gere puts it, going to be “the downfall of his life”? And what’s your take on Evan Rachel Wood‘s bad-mother Liz and Jordan Roth’s fashionista fixer, Steven? We’re sort of Bret-level obsessed with them.
